William Martin
William B. Martin, 62, of Gladwin, died Friday, Feb. 15, at his home. He has
been in failing health since 1955. Born in Battle Creek on March 30, 1911, he was an electrician
for Pontiac Motors. Mr. Martin moved to Gladwin County in 1968, and was a member of the Hay
Township Senior Citizens Club. He was married to the former Louise Domann in June 1934, in Pontiac.
Besides his wife, he is survived by two sons, William Martin of Gladwin and Richard Henry of
Pontiac; three granddaughters, Dawn, Della and Zina Martin, who live with them; one brother, Raymond
of Ft. Myers, Fla.; and a half-brother, Clarence Robinson of Pontiac.
Rites were held Monday at 1 p.m. from the Mathews Funeral Home. The Rev. Jerry Locher officiated
and burial was in the Highland Cemetery.
